    FWIW I got a 1 1/2 ton jack mount from Weldtec Designs, it took some alterations to get my jack to fit, maybe the alum. 1 1/2 ton jacks vary in dimension? I'm planning on mounting the plate in the bed, probably on top of the wheel well close to the cab, then put the jack in there for off road trips, sorry no pics yet. I also have a jack extension from C4 on the way. I'm planning on the 1 1/2 ton jack as a backup to the factory jack. I also have a 2 ton pro eagle jack with the mounting plate, but it's a large, heavy beast, probably overkill for a Tacoma.
